One frequent problem that homeowners encounter is when the AC unit does not cool as efficiently as it once did. This is frequently due to a contaminated or blocked air filter. Replacing your air filter is an easy DIY job that can be performed routinely to ensure system efficiency. A clogged filter impedes airflow, causing your AC repair Westlake Village system to exert extra effort and consume more energy than needed. Just find the air filter compartment in your unit, take out the old filter, and insert a new, clean one. Don’t forget to change filters every 1-3 months, based on how often they’re used and what type they are. Another issue could be strange sounds coming from the AC unit. Noisy grinding, squealing, or rattling noises may suggest mechanical problems generally related to belts or bearings. If you're familiar with basic troubleshooting, you can examine the unit by disconnecting the power and assessing components for damage. Adjusting components or applying lubrication to moving parts might fix minor problems, but if you notice significant issues or feel unsure, it’s essential to reach out to an expert in AC repair Westlake Village for a professional evaluation and repair. If you are facing a water leak, it could be because of a clogged condensate drain line. This issue can typically lead to water accumulating and spilling over. Using a wet-dry vacuum or a slim brush to clear the line can help restore correct water flow. Nevertheless, ongoing leaks should be thoroughly investigated by professionals in AC repair Westlake Village to avoid additional damage.
Finally, error codes displayed on your AC unit can provide insights into any internal problems that may exist. Consult your unit’s manual to interpret these messages. Often, these codes suggest simple solutions such as verifying thermostat settings or inspecting circuit breakers.
